Murray Earns Second Weekly RMAC Honor

CO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. – Amber Murray earned her second RMAC West Division Player of the Week award after averaging 28.5 points and seven rebounds to lead Western State to an undefeated record last week. It’s the fourth time this season the weekly award has gone to the Mountaineers, and the first since Murray picked up the honor Jan. 11.

Murray opened the week with 25 points off eight-of-17 shooting against Mesa State during a 64-47 victory in Brownson Arena Jan. 26. She went six-of-seven from the free-throw line, grabbed eight rebounds and recorded three assists.

Murray followed with a season-high 32-point performance against Western New Mexico Jan. 30 and matched her career-best with five three-pointers in an 89-64 victory. Her scoring output was the most in the RMAC over the week and is tied for the best performance in the conference this season.

Murray is second in the conference in scoring with 17.6 points per game, behind the RMAC East Division Player of the Week Rachel Petri, who is averaging 19.5 points per game for Chadron State.

Murray and the rest of the Mountaineers remain at home this weekend to host rival Adams State Friday night, followed by No. 8 Fort Lewis Saturday night. Both games start at 6 p.m. in Paul Wright Gym.
